How to Convert Petabyte to Terabyte

How many terabytes are in a petabyte?
1 Petabyte (PB) is equal to 1000 Terabyte (TB). To convert petabytes to terabytes, multiply your value by 1000.
How do I convert petabyte to terabyte?
To convert Petabyte to Terabyte, use the formula: Terabyte = Petabyte × 1000. For example, 5 PB = 5000 TB.
